好兵帅克
Hǎo bīng Shuài kè
Pinyin

Definition

好兵帅克
 - 
Hǎo bīng Shuài kè
  1. The Good Soldier Švejk (Schweik), satirical novel by Czech author Jaroslav Hašek (1883-1923)
